Johann-Julius-Hecker-Schule is a public Integrated Secondary School (ISS) in Marzahn-Hellersdorf. In the 2024/25 school year, 576 students attended the school. English is the first foreign language; French, Russian, and Spanish are also taught. The full-day program is optional, so the afternoon is an offer that families book. Entrance, elevator, and WC are accessible. The school has no Oberstufe of its own; the route to the Abitur runs through a partner Oberstufe or an Oberstufenzentrum.

Applications in Recent Years

According to the official figures, Johann-Julius-Hecker-Schule had enough places in all 3 recorded years. The number of places varied slightly. Most recently, in 2026/27, there were 100 first-choice applications for 135 places. That is a demand ratio of 74 percent.
